Why Choose an Artificial Grass Mat for Your Dog?

Traditional potty training can be challenging, especially for apartment dwellers or owners with limited outdoor space. Artificial grass mats offer a fantastic alternative. They mimic the feel of real grass, encouraging your dog to use the designated area. This is particularly useful for dogs who are hesitant to eliminate on concrete or other hard surfaces. Beyond convenience, these mats are easy to clean, eliminating odors and maintaining hygiene. They’re also a great option for senior dogs or those with mobility issues who may have difficulty getting outside.

Key Benefits: Encourages natural potty behavior, easy to clean and maintain, ideal for indoor or balcony use, hygienic and odor-free, suitable for all dog breeds and ages.

Types of Artificial Grass Mats for Dogs

Not all artificial grass mats for dogs are created equal. They vary in terms of materials, pile height, drainage capabilities, and size. Common types include:

  • Polyethylene (PE) Grass: Soft, realistic feel, often preferred by dogs.
  • Polypropylene (PP) Grass: More affordable, but less durable than PE.
  • Drainage Layer: Crucial for preventing odors and maintaining hygiene. Options include felt, rubber, and perforated layers.
  • Backing Material: Determines the mat’s stability and durability.

Choosing the right type depends on your dog’s size, your budget, and where you plan to use the mat.

Key Considerations:

• Material durability (PE vs. PP)

• Effective drainage system

• Size appropriate for your dog

• Ease of cleaning

Installation and Maintenance Tips

Installing an artificial grass mat for dogs is generally straightforward. Simply unroll the mat and place it on a flat, stable surface. For indoor use, consider placing a waterproof liner underneath to protect your flooring. Maintenance is equally easy: regularly rinse the mat with water to remove waste. For stubborn odors, use an enzymatic cleaner specifically designed for pet waste. Avoid harsh chemicals that could damage the grass fibers or harm your dog. Choosing the Right Size: A Quick Guide

Selecting the correct size is vital for your dog's comfort and successful use of the mat. Consider the following guidelines:

Dog Size Recommended Mat Size
Small (under 20 lbs) 2ft x 3ft
Medium (20-50 lbs) 3ft x 4ft
Large (50+ lbs) 4ft x 6ft or larger

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

How often should I clean the artificial grass mat?

The frequency of cleaning depends on how often your dog uses the mat. However, it's generally recommended to rinse the mat with water at least once a week, or more frequently if needed. For solid waste, remove it immediately and rinse the area thoroughly. A deeper clean with an enzymatic cleaner should be performed monthly, or as needed to eliminate odors. Regular cleaning prevents bacteria buildup and maintains the mat's hygiene.

Is artificial grass safe for my dog?

Generally, yes, artificial grass is safe for dogs. However, it's crucial to choose a high-quality mat made from non-toxic materials like polyethylene (PE). Avoid mats with lead or other harmful chemicals. Ensure the mat has a good drainage system to prevent the buildup of bacteria. Monitor your dog for any allergic reactions or skin irritation, though these are rare.

Can I use an artificial grass mat outdoors?

Yes, many artificial grass mats are designed for outdoor use. However, ensure the mat has a good drainage system to prevent waterlogging. Consider choosing a mat with UV protection to prevent fading from sunlight. Secure the mat to prevent it from blowing away in windy conditions. Regular cleaning is especially important for outdoor mats to remove debris and maintain hygiene.

How do I store the mat when not in use?

When not in use, thoroughly clean and dry the artificial grass mat. Store it in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ight. Roll it up loosely and avoid folding it tightly to prevent creases. Storing it in a breathable bag will help prevent mold and mildew.
